Montreal is Canada’s epicentre of art and culture, a magnet for young artists and entrepreneurs looking for a place to develop their craft and connect with like-minded people. It is also one of the most welcoming cities in Canada, attracting different groups of people as tourists or permanent residents. Even though French is Montreal’s official language and more than 50% of the population speaks only French, English also has a prominent place, with more than 500,000 speakers, according to the 2016 census. Learn English for Culture: If you would like to experience Montreal’s culture, you will be happy to know that Montrealers love to party and the city enjoys an international reputation for its festive atmosphere. Each year, Montreal hosts some 100 festivals and public events, such as the St-Ambroise Montreal Fringe Festival. With more than 800 performances crammed into 20 days, you will be able to enjoy cinema and theatre, dance and music shows, taste the local cuisine and more! These performances are mostly delivered in English, so take some lessons with us before the festival to make the most out of this fantastic experience! And if you love cinema and would like to put your new listening skills to use, you should attend the Montreal World Film Festival. Founded in 1977, this is one of Canada's oldest international film festivals, featuring more than 50 movies in English every year.
